WitrynaIf you like walking, groups such as Ramblers Wellbeing Walks can support people who have health problems, including mental health conditions. Exercise on prescription. If you have not exercised for a long time or are concerned about the effects of exercise on your body or health, ask a GP about exercise on prescription. WitrynaWalking or running groups – Walking for Health, Let’s Walk Cymru, Ramblers and Run Together all organise free, inclusive local groups with trained volunteers. “I’m not the sporty type, but I love walking. It really lifts my mood.” Outdoors gyms – some local parks have free outdoors gym equipment you can use.
